POSITION/TITLE: Corporate Planning Analyst

DEPARTMENT: Corporate Planning

LOCATION: Johns Creek Office

REPORTS TO: Manager, Corporate Planning

POSITION SUMMARY:

The Corporate Planning team serves as a vital bridge between the U.S. local entity (NUSA) and Japan Headquarters (HQ), ensuring timely reporting and cross-border alignment. This position will be responsible for driving various critical and wide-ranging business initiatives, including budget planning, mid-term business plan formulation, sales management system enhancements, production/logistics optimization, and cross-functional project management.

Initially, the successful candidate will own assigned data aggregation, financial analysis and material preparation for ongoing high-priority projects. Additionally, the role is responsible for ad-hoc data analysis requests from executive management and supporting the overall operational capacity of the team while gaining a comprehensive understanding of our business operations. Ultimately, the job holder will independently plan and execute major projects as the primary owner/project manager.

Key Responsibilities

1. Corporate Planning & Performance Management (Leading Planning, Budgeting, and Profitability Analysis)

  • Coordinate with various departments to collect, aggregate, and analyze data for budgeting, mid-term business planning, and key performance management frameworks (KPIs, ROIC, etc.).
  • Run simulations and identify business challenges for business portfolio analysis and segment/product profitability evaluations (such as visualizing marginal profits).
  • Assume full ownership of specific areas of budgeting and mid-term business planning, independently leading plan formulations and cross-border adjustments with HQ.

2. Enhancing Sales Management & Data Visualization

  • Track progress of sales and order data, and update/create variance (gap) analysis reports against targets for executive review.
  • Support the automation and standardization of sales and marketing reports by leveraging internal data tools (BI tools, Tableau, Excel, etc.).
  • Conduct data analysis on sales discount rules and specific market/customer performances to propose concrete improvement measures to the sales department.

3. Project Management Office (PMO) & Cross-Functional Coordination

  • Serve as Project Manager, including managing stakeholders, timelines and schedules via Gantt charts and needed resources, for assigned cross-functional initiatives, such as new product development and factory production transfers.
  • Respond promptly to urgent data extraction and research requests (ad-hoc analysis) from management and structure the findings into clear executive reports.
  • Lead information sharing, negotiations, and alignments with relevant stakeholders (Japan HQ, Logistics, QC, external vendors, etc.) for corporate and logistics operational tasks, such as tracking reciprocal tariff/duty refunds.

4. Process Standardization & Documentation

  • Document data aggregation processes and recurring reporting workflows that are currently reliant on specific individuals. Create and maintain clear step-by-step manuals to ensure workflow efficiency and operational continuity.

Qualifications & Skills

Required Qualifications

  • Education: Bachelor’s degree in Business Administration, Accounting, Finance, Data Analytics or related field.
  • Professional Experience: 3 to 5 years of professional experience leading data analysis or report preparation in Corporate Planning, Finance/Accounting, Sales Planning, Business Analysis, or Management Consulting. (Agility and data processing speed are valued over years of experience).
  • Data Analysis Skills: Advanced Excel skills (proficiency in formulas, pivot tables, data manipulation, and cross-referencing large datasets).
  • Flexibility & Multi-Tasking: Ability to handle multiple projects simultaneously with speed and agility in a fast-paced, ad-hoc environment where priorities can shift rapidly.
  • Language & Communication Skills:
    • Japanese: Business level or higher is mandatory (Native or equivalent). Must be able to independently manage seamless information exchange, handle complex business requirements, and draft/coordinate materials with Japan HQ (Corporate Planning and other related divisions).
    • English: Business level. Ability to clearly understand directives from local management and local staff, translating them accurately into data and structured documentation.

Preferred Qualifications

  • Data Visualization Skills: Hands-on experience with BI tools (Tableau, Power BI, etc.) or experience in data validation.
  • Industry Knowledge: Professional background or foundational knowledge in the manufacturing sector, supply chain, or logistics operations.
  • Project Management: Experience in project tracking (PMO) or creating structured business process documentation and manuals.
  • ERP Systems: Foundational knowledge of data extraction and system utilization using ERP platforms (such as IFS).
